Default Wavelets to wash over face

I watched the Webinar last night and one of the many points that was pointed out was while swimming backstroke - to let the head be fully supported by the water and you would know you were accomplishing this if the wavelets washed over ones face.
Over the last month my backstroke has been feeling inefficient and awkward. This morning at the pool I checked out the head position and sure enough it was slightly raised. Once I allowed the small waves to wash over my face my stroke smoothed out and stroke count went down and perceived effort went way down.

My front facing strokes were okay.
